DevOps Engineer | Codersbrain
full-time
Posted on July 15, 2025
Job Description
DevOps Engineer
Company Overview
(Company information not provided.)
Job Summary
The DevOps Engineer will play a crucial role in designing, implementing, and maintaining Continuous Integration and Continuous Delivery (CI/CD) pipelines using Azure DevOps. This position will ensure the operational efficiency of Azure cloud environments while collaborating closely with development and operations teams to enhance application delivery, system performance, and security.
Responsibilities
- Design and implement CI/CD pipelines using Azure DevOps to automate build, test, and deployment processes.
- Manage and maintain Azure cloud environments, ensuring optimal performance, security, and scalability.
- Collaborate with development and operations teams to streamline processes and enhance application delivery.
- Monitor system performance and troubleshoot issues to ensure high availability and reliability.
- Implement infrastructure as code (IaC) using tools such as Azure Resource Manager, Terraform, or ARM templates.
- Develop and enforce best practices for DevOps processes, including source control, versioning, and release management.
- Conduct regular system audits and implement security best practices to protect data and applications.
- Stay up-to-date with the latest Azure technologies and DevOps trends to continuously improve practices.
- Exhibit strong hands-on experience with monorepo and understanding of the use of GitHub Actions to build a private turborepo to speed up the build.
- Work with the development team to reduce build time and establish code coverage.
Qualifications
- Proven experience as a DevOps Engineer, specifically with Azure cloud services.
- Strong knowledge of CI/CD tools and methodologies, particularly with Azure DevOps.
- Proficiency in scripting languages such as PowerShell, Bash, or Python.
- Experience with containerization technologies like Docker and orchestration tools like Kubernetes.
- Familiarity with monitoring tools (e.g., Azure Monitor, Grafana) and logging frameworks.
- Excellent problem-solving skills and the ability to work collaboratively in a team environment.
Preferred Skills
- Experience with Agile methodologies.
- Knowledge of security best practices in cloud environments.
- Certifications in Azure (e.g., Azure Solutions Architect, Azure DevOps Engineer) are a plus.
Experience
(Experience requirements not provided.)
Environment
(Work setting details not provided.)
Salary
(Salary information not provided.)
Growth Opportunities
(Career advancement details not provided.)
Benefits
(Benefits information not provided.)